I literally just got through a good bit of this, so perfect lol. Basically, youre missing the “Dark Nights: Metal” and “Justice League: No Justice” stuff that scott snyder also wrote. On dc infinite, theres a section with about 36 issues under that name that give the story. After, theres a four issue event called “No Justice”. Then, it finishes and we get “Justice League Odyssey.” And “Justice League Dark”. Neither of those runs are incredibly important to the source wall stuff you mentioned, but they were the reason i read through the Dark Nights Metal, and im enjoying them. You really just need to read “Dark Nights Metal” and “No Justice” to get it, and the 36 issues i mentioned are probably not all necessary. I believe you only have about a dozen necessary issues. Id recommend to keep readin it, i enjoyed it all.

To simplify, you need to read “Dark Nights Metal” and “Justice League: No Justice”.
